Stress-Free Selling® - Tough Economy, Tough Competition
On May 15, the New York Times reported that starting this Fall, Turner TV is offering advertisers spots that capitalize on the content of the movies! Hearing this, AMC cable network created Audience Identity Metrics so they can offer packages to advertisers that are tailored to the behavior of the consumers who watch those movies. Contextual online advertising is commonplace, and while online advertising grows, it is changing the way advertisers think about traditional print media. Publishers Information Bureau recently reported consumer magazines ad revenue decreased 1.2% the first quarter 2008 and ad pages sank 6.4%. This is a brief State of the Advertising Industry. Why developing your Sales Managers is the key to your sales success
It may surprise you to discover that many Sales Managers learn how to be a Manager on their own. According to the latest international study on Sales Training and Sales Force Effectiveness, many Sales Managers are given very little or no support when it comes to being a competent, effective Sales Manager. In fact, many Sales Managers reported that they were given no formal training in Sales Management practices, either before or during their tenure as a Sales Manager. The study reported that Sales Management training is the category of sales training that is addressed with the least frequency, in fact it is less than annually or not at all.
